Typically, wood window installation services encompass a range of tasks designed to improve both the appearance and functionality of existing window openings. These services often include removing old or damaged windows, preparing the rough openings, and fitting new or replacement wood windows that match the property's style. Contractors may also handle the sealing, insulation, and finishing touches necessary to ensure the windows operate smoothly and provide proper weather resistance. Many local service providers offer consultation to help property owners select the best window styles, finishes, and features suited to their specific needs and preferences.

Spring Checklist

Before comparing options, clearly describe your wood window installation project to help local contractors provide accurate assistance.

  • Assess window frame condition - ensure the existing frames are in good shape to support new wood windows and identify any necessary repairs.
  • Verify proper measurements - accurate sizing is essential for a secure and energy-efficient fit, so precise measurements should be taken by service providers.
  • Check for proper insulation and sealing - ensure the installation includes adequate insulation to prevent drafts and improve energy efficiency.
  • Evaluate hardware and locking mechanisms - confirm that hinges, locks, and handles are functional and compatible with the new windows.
  • Ensure correct window placement and operation - windows should open smoothly and be correctly aligned for ease of use and security.
  • Confirm weatherproofing details - proper flashing and sealing are necessary to prevent water infiltration and protect the home during spring rains.

Work planning considerations are particularly relevant during spring, as unpredictable weather can impact project timelines and procedures. Homeowners should inquire how local contractors plan around potential rain or temperature swings, and whether they have contingency plans in place. Effective planning includes scheduling work during periods of stable weather and ensuring that materials are protected from moisture. Contractors who demonstrate an understanding of seasonal planning and can accommodate weather-related adjustments are better positioned to deliver a smooth installation process that aligns with spring’s seasonal demands.
